Maryam Amir Jalali quickly became a household name thanks to her memorable performances in television sitcoms and comedy series, which were highly popular with audiences. Her roles often carried a mix of humor, wit, and warmth, making her characters relatable and beloved by viewers.

Beyond television, Maryam Amir Jalali has also appeared inĀ cinema, often in supporting but memorable roles. In film, she often portrays maternal figures or comedic characters, balancing lightheartedness with emotional depth.
